Navigating NIL Opportunities as a 4A TE Prospect
As a tight end prospect at a 4A program like Edna Karr Cougars, understanding NIL opportunities can be a game-changer for your future. Start by researching your state's laws and regulations regarding high school athletes and NIL deals. In Louisiana, the LHSAA has guidelines for endorsement and sponsorship agreements. Next, identify your unique selling points, such as your high school football stats, academic achievements, and community involvement. Create a highlight reel showcasing your skills and share it on social media platforms. For example, if you have a 4.5 GPA and 1,000 receiving yards in your junior year, highlight these achievements in your reel. Finally, consider partnering with local businesses or brands that align with your values and interests. This could lead to sponsored content, appearances, or even a part-time job. By taking these steps, you can establish a strong online presence and increase your NIL opportunities.
